Police responded to Zion Lutheran School in Marengo Monday morning after knives were found on the playground, officials said.

The Marengo Police Department responded to Zion Lutheran School, 408 Jackson Street, after students reportedly found knives on the playground Monday morning.

The school was placed on soft lockdown, which means people could not enter or leave the building.

Officers assisted in searching school grounds and did not locate anything of further concern, the police department said.

“There is nothing at this time to indicate that there was any sort of threat or safety concern other than the existence of the items located,” the department said in a statement.

It is unknown how the knives got onto the playground or if police have identified anyone involved.
